Puerto Vallarta teacher arrested for sexual abuse of two students

The Attorney General's Office of Jalisco reported that an arrest warrant was issued against a primary school teacher accused of participating in the sexual abuse of two minors in December 2018, in the municipality of Puerto Vallarta.

He noted that the injunction was granted by a judge of Control and Orality, through which the teacher was arrested and placed at the disposal of the judicial authority to be prosecuted for the crimes of aggravated child sexual abuse and corruption of minors.
